Biography of Willow Shields

Willow Shields, born on June 1, 2000, in Albuquerque, New Mexico, is an American actress who rose to fame through her role in one of the most successful film franchises of the 2010s. From a young age, Shields demonstrated a natural talent for acting that would eventually lead her to Hollywood stardom.

Full Name: Willow Camille Reign Shields
Date of Birth: June 1, 2000
Place of Birth: Albuquerque, New Mexico, USA
Occupation: Actress
Years Active: 2008–present
Known For: Playing Primrose Everdeen in The Hunger Games series
Family: Has a twin sister, Autumn Shields, and an older brother, River Shields
Breakthrough Role: Primrose Everdeen in The Hunger Games (2012)

Early Career and Rise to Fame

Before becoming a household name through The Hunger Games, Willow Shields had already begun making her mark in the entertainment industry. In 2011, she received the role of homeless girl Grace in the CBS project "Beyond the Blackboard," showcasing her ability to portray complex characters even at a young age. This early role demonstrated the emotional depth that would later make her perfect for the role of Primrose Everdeen.

Her casting as Primrose in The Hunger Games came when she was just 11 years old, and she continued to portray the character throughout the entire film franchise. The role required her to balance innocence with the harsh realities of the dystopian world, a challenge she met with remarkable skill. As the younger sister of Katniss (Jennifer Lawrence), Shields' character served as both a symbol of hope and a reminder of what was at stake in the brutal competition.
